The British Sun Bathers Association (BSBA) of 1943 and the Federation of British Sun Clubs (FBSC) of 1953 merged to form the Central Council for British Naturism (CCBN) in 1964 which officially became British Naturism in 2009.Complaints have come in about Pilchard Cove possibly because of the far end being a meeting place for the gay community, still a risky business in 1961. Family beauty contest at a nudist camp, 1965. In 1922 the English Gymnosophical Society was formed based on the work into naturism of Harold Booth. British Naturism can trace its origins back to 1891 and the Fellowship for the Naked Trust in British India. The first annual naturist world congress was held in London in 1951 although the International Naturist Federation (INF) was officially founded in 1953 in Montalivet in France. In 1970 International Naturist Federation held its annual congress in Britain.
